Taxonomic Classification

Rank Agile Mangabey gray mouse lemur
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class same Mammalia (Mammals)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order same Primates (Primates) Primates (Primates)
Family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) Cheirogaleidae
Genus Cercocebus Microcebus
Species Cercocebus agilis Microcebus murinus

Evolutionary Relationship

Agile Mangabey and gray mouse lemur share a common ancestor at the Order level: Primates. (Primates)
